README - VRMakePano

VRMakePano is a simple application that converts a panoramic image 
into a QuickTime VR panoramic movie. The panoramic image must be 
rotated 90 counterclockwise from its normal orientation, so that the 
image is taller than it is wide. The QuickTime VR movie created by 
VRMakePano is either a version 2.0 QTVR movie or a version 1.0 QTVR 
movie; you select the version using the Test menu.

VRMakePano is distributed as sample code. It uses the graphics 
importer routines introduced in QuickTime 2.5 to open any available 
image file. Then it builds the QTVR file according to the documented 
file format. As an added bonus, VRMakePano shows the tile of the 
picture it's currently compressing as it churns through the image. 
(You can get rid of that behavior by setting a compile flag.)

The essential code is found in the file VRMakePano.c. This code 
compiles and runs on both MacOS and Windows platforms.
